This is an investigational combination therapeutic strategy being evaluated in a Phase 1 clinical trial (NCT05887167) led by Dr. Joshua Sasine at Cedars-Sinai Medical Center. The approach involves the collection of autologous hematopoietic stem cells (HSCs) from patients with relapsed or refractory hematological malignancies prior to the administration of an FDA-approved chimeric antigen receptor (CAR) T-cell therapy. The collected HSCs are then infused back into the patient (typically on Day 10 post-CAR T infusion) to support hematopoietic recovery and potentially mitigate common CAR T-associated toxicities, such as prolonged cytopenias, cytokine release syndrome (CRS), and immune effector cell-associated neurotoxicity syndrome (ICANS). The study targets various B-cell malignancies, including diffuse large B-cell lymphoma (DLBCL), mantle cell lymphoma (MCL), acute lymphoblastic leukemia (ALL), and multiple myeloma (MM).
